Understanding the Back Stitch Technique

The back stitch is a versatile and durable hand-sewing method known for its strength and clean appearance on both visible and hidden seams. Unlike running stitch, which relies on intermittent spacing, back stitch involves overlapping stitches that create a continuous line, making it ideal for seams that require durability and flexibility. This technique is widely used in tailoring, costume creation, and detailed embroidery work where precision is non-negotiable. A well-executed back stitch leaves minimal perforation marks and distributes tension evenly across the fabric, preventing puckering or thread breakage.

Key Elements to Observe in Instructional Videos

  • Needle angle and entry point on the fabric
  • Consistency of stitch length and spacing
  • Hand positioning and finger placement for control
  • Thread tension management to avoid knots or looseness
  • Rhythm and flow to maintain even stitching
  • Use of thimbles or stabilizers for comfort and accuracy

Applications Across Craft Disciplines

Beyond traditional sewing, the back stitch plays a critical role in embroidery, sashiko, and even mechanical repair work where precise thread reinforcement is required. Crafters use this stitch to outline designs, create detailed lettering, or reinforce stress points on garments. In historical textile restoration, back stitch is often the method of choice for repairing seams with minimal visual impact.
